Vibration isolator DVA.3-75-55-M12-40 Z050420
Vibration and noise damping in machines and equipment
The DVA.3-75-55-M12-40 vibration isolator is an element designed for effective vibration damping and noise reduction generated by operating machines and equipment. Its construction based on 40 Shore A rubber allows for the absorption of vibration energy, minimizing its transmission to the environment. This translates to increased work comfort, improved safety, and extended machine life.
Construction and application
The vibration isolator is characterized by a cylindrical structure, made with galvanized steel inserts to ensure corrosion resistance. It has an internal M12 thread, allowing for easy assembly and disassembly. A diameter of 75 mm and a height of 55 mm make it a universal element, finding application in many industrial sectors. It is ideal for mounting components such as motors, fans or pumps, as well as for isolating housings and structural elements.
Key features and benefits
- Effective vibration damping: 40 Shore A rubber effectively absorbs vibration energy, reducing noise and vibration.
- Corrosion resistance: Galvanized steel inserts ensure durability and resistance to external factors.
- Easy installation: The internal M12 thread facilitates quick and secure mounting of the vibration isolator.
- Versatility: Compact dimensions (diameter 75 mm, height 55 mm) allow for use in various applications.
- Application in various conditions: Suitable for operation in a wide temperature range – from -40°C to +80°C.
- Protection of machines and equipment: Reducing vibrations translates to less wear on machine components and extending their service life.
- Improved work comfort: Reducing noise and vibration has a positive impact on the working environment for operators.
